首页 > 使用Cordova插件从相册选择图片预览问题

使用Cordova插件从相册选择图片预览问题

使用Cordova插件从相册选择图片显示后如何预览:

        <div class="item" >
            <img ng-repeat="img in images_list" style="width:40px;height:40px;" src="{{img.url}}">
        </div>
        
       $scope.addFromAlbum = function() {
        plugins.imagePicker.getPictures(
            function(results) {
                for (var i = 0; i < results.length; i++) {
                    var obj = {};
                    obj.url = results[i];
                    $scope.images_list.push(obj);
                }
            },
            function(error) {
                console.log('Error: ' + error);
            }, {
                maximumImagesCount: 10,
                quality: 100
            }
        );

    }

URL其实是一个指向手机本地存储图片的路径,请问如何预览图片


你这是angular写的啊,可以借助ZoomVisualizer这个插件实现预览,链接地址:http://down.admin5.com/demo/code_pop/19/595/


请问下你这个问题搞定了吗?我用着取到图片之后,显示图片的时候他一直提示我无法读取本地文件


我想本地图片应该可以加载到IMG标签中预览的。无法显示的原因可能是CSP的原因,可以设置一下网页的CSP标签。如有问题请自行查看我的这篇博文:
网页CSP(Content-Security-Policy)设置的秘密

【热门文章】
【热门文章】